Athens: It emerged on Friday that Greece would be inclined to concede with Turkey on delimiting their respective fiscal zones at sea. “My door is always open, but this dialogue presupposes a reduction in unnecessary tensions,” Greek Prime Minister Kyriakos Mitsotakis stated during Angela Merkel’s visit to Athens.
